A Graph-Based Approach to Optimal Scan Chain Stitching Using RTL Design Descriptions

被引:1
|
作者
Zaourar, Lilia [1 ]
Kieffer, Yann [2 ,3 ]
Aktouf, Chouki [4 ]
机构
[1] Univ Paris 06, SOC Dept, Lab LIP6, 4 Pl Jussieu, F-75252 Paris 05, France
[2] Grenoble Inst Technol, LCIS, F-26000 Valence, France
[3] Univ Grenoble, F-26000 Valence, France
[4] DeFacTo Technol, F-38430 Moirans, France
关键词
D O I
10.1155/2012/312808
中图分类号
TP3 [计算技术、计算机技术];
学科分类号
0812 ;
摘要
The scan chain insertion problem is one of the mandatory logic insertion design tasks. The scanning of designs is a very efficient way of improving their testability. But it does impact size and performance, depending on the stitching ordering of the scan chain. In this paper, we propose a graph-based approach to a stitching algorithm for automatic and optimal scan chain insertion at the RTL. Our method is divided into two main steps. The first one builds graph models for inferring logical proximity information from the design, and then the second one uses classic approximation algorithms for the traveling salesman problem to determine the best scan-stitching ordering. We show how this algorithm allows the decrease of the cost of both scan analysis and implementation, by measuring total wirelength on placed and routed benchmark designs, both academic and industrial.
引用
收藏
页数:11
相关论文
共 50 条
  • [1] Using stack reconstruction on RTL orthogonal scan chain design
    Tsai, Chia-Chun
    Huang, Hann-Cheng
    Lee, Trong-Yen
    Lee, Wen-Ta
    Wu, Jan-Ou
    JOURNAL OF INFORMATION SCIENCE AND ENGINEERING, 2006, 22 (06) : 1585 - 1599
  • [2] A Graph-Based Approach to Learn Semantic Descriptions of Data Sources
    Taheriyan, Mohsen
    Knoblock, Craig A.
    Szekely, Pedro
    Ambite, Jose Luis
    SEMANTIC WEB - ISWC 2013, PART I, 2013, 8218 : 607 - 623
  • [3] A Graph-Based Approach for Inferring Semantic Descriptions of Wikipedia Tables
    Vu, Binh
    Knoblock, Craig A.
    Szekely, Pedro
    Minh Pham
    Pujara, Jay
    SEMANTIC WEB - ISWC 2021, 2021, 12922 : 304 - 320
  • [4] Performance Analysis of Graph-based Track Stitching
    Mori, Shozo
    Chong, Chee-Yee
    2013 16TH INTERNATIONAL CONFERENCE ON INFORMATION FUSION (FUSION), 2013, : 196 - 203
  • [5] Graph-based SLAM Approach for Environments with Laser Scan Ambiguity
    Oh, Taekjun
    Kim, Hyungjin
    Jung, Kwangyik
    Myung, Hyun
    2015 12TH INTERNATIONAL CONFERENCE ON UBIQUITOUS ROBOTS AND AMBIENT INTELLIGENCE (URAI), 2015, : 139 - 141
  • [6] Graph-Based Registration and Blending for Undersea Image Stitching
    Yang, Xu
    Liu, Zhi-Yong
    Qiao, Hong
    Su, Jian-Hua
    Ji, Da-Xiong
    Zang, Ai-Yun
    Huang, Hai
    ROBOTICA, 2020, 38 (03) : 396 - 409
  • [7] Verification of Web Service Descriptions using Graph-based Traversal Algorithms
    Gooneratne, Nalaka
    Tari, Zahir
    Harland, James
    APPLIED COMPUTING 2007, VOL 1 AND 2, 2007, : 1385 - 1392
  • [8] A Combined Graph-based Approach for Systems Design And Verification
    Zoubeir, Najet
    Khalfallah, Adel
    MODELSWARD 2015 PROCEEDINGS OF THE 3RD INTERNATIONAL CONFERENCE ON MODEL-DRIVEN ENGINEERING AND SOFTWARE DEVELOPMENT, 2015, : 346 - 353
  • [9] Molecular Quantum Circuit Design: A Graph-Based Approach
    Kottmann, Jakob S.
    QUANTUM, 2023, 7
  • [10] A Graph-Based Approach for the DNA Word Design Problem
    Luncasu, Victor
    Raschip, Madalina
    IEEE-ACM TRANSACTIONS ON COMPUTATIONAL BIOLOGY AND BIOINFORMATICS, 2021, 18 (06) : 2747 - 2752